RpnCalc is the best RPN calculator on the Android Market.

It has an interface that users RPN calculators will be completely at home with, including these features:
Scientific mode
Basic (large key) mode
20 Memories
Key click (haptic feedback)
Continouous memory
16-level stack (configurable)
Front four stack elements displayed
RpnCalc has a sixteen-level stack to hold more data. The front four elements on the stack are visible at all times, making it much easier to keep track of where you are in your calculations.
"Calculator tape" records your calculations and can be shared via email, bluetooth, etc.

See http://www.efalk.org/RpnCalc/ for manual

Oh, and here's the privacy policy: RpnCalc never collects any private data of any sort. It never connects to the internet. It doesn't even run ads.

some of HP-41 functions are not properly supported. it does have Last-x, but when I enter a number and press "enter" 2 more times, the T register value is not "sticky"... it drops down and resets to zero on multiple actions. In all HP Rev Polish calculators, this was a VERY useful feature, since it allows unlimited accumulation of a value by repeatedly executing + (add) or rising a number to an integer power by repeatedly executing a multipy.
